Error description

  • Running TSO/E REXX exec fails with MSGCSV003I IRXM01EN MODULE
    NOT FOUND and MSGCSV028I jobname... stepname...
    .
    When customizing REXX to run on your system, you may change
    default parameters that IRXINIT will use to initialize a
    language processor environment.  You change the default
    parameters by re-linking modified copies of the parameter
    modules IRXPARMS (MVS), IRXTSPRM (TSO), and IRXISPRM(ISPF).
    Sample copies of these modules are provided in SYS1.SAMPLIB
    members TSOREXX1, TSOREXX2, and TSOREXX3.
    .
    One of the values that can be changed is the LANGUAGE in which
    REXX messages are displayed.  In TSO/E 2.1.0 (both XA and ESA)
    and TSO/E 2.1.1, this field is a 2-byte character field of AE.
    The declaration in the SAMPLIB member is as follows:
    PARMBLOCK_LANGUAGE DC CL2'AE' /* Language is American English*/
    .
    TSO/E 2.2 and higher uses a 3-byte field.  Possible values are:
    CHS - Simplified Chinese
    CHT - Traditional Chinese
    DAN - Danish
    DEU - German
    ENP - US Englis in uppercase
    ENU - US English in mixed case
    ESP - Spanish
    FRA - French
    JPN - Japanese
    KOR - Korean
    PTB - Brazilian Portuguese
    .
    If you have multiple systems, and copy IRXPARMS, IRXTSPRM, and
    IRXISPRM from a TSO/E 2.2 or higher system to a TSO/E 2.1
    system, the message-module name will be built incorrectly and
    IRXEMSG will attempt to load an invalid module resulting in
    Content Supervisor errors messages: CSV003I and CSV028I for
    modules beginning with IRXM .
    .
    At TSO/E 2.1 (2.1.0 and 2.1.1) IRXEMSG dynamicly builds the
    message-module name with:
    -  Prefix of IRX
    -  4th character of M for message
    -  2-byte numeric value
    -  2-byte field indicating language
    This 2-byte language field is taken directly from the PARMBLOCK
    built from IRXPARMS, IRXTSPRM, or IRXISPRM.
    .
    It is possible to see MSGCSV003I for module names such as
    IRXM01CH  IRXM01DA  IRXM01DE  IRXM01EN  IRXM01ES  IRXM01FR
    IRXM01JP  IRXM01PT
    .
    The numeric value in the 5th and 6th character does not have
    to be 01 or 03.
    .
    The last two characters can be any value that is declared in
    IRXPARMS, IRXTSPRM, or IRXISPRM.  It is not restricted to these
    values.  REXX processing simply picks up 2 bytes and inserts
    it into the module name.
    .
    To resolve this problem:
    Correct the error in IRXPARMS, IRXTSPRM, and IRXISPRM and
    re-link as directed in TSO/E REXX REFERENCE (SC28-1883).
